This video tutorial covers the concepts of multiplying and dividing decimals. It begins with an introduction to the topic, followed by detailed steps and examples for multiplying decimals. The tutorial then provides practice problems to reinforce learning. It continues with instructions on dividing decimals by whole numbers and concludes with a section on dividing decimals by other decimals, including examples and step-by-step guidance.
